Permits and ordinances
The City of Oak Creek manages boulevard and right-of-way trees. Private-yard removals typically don't require a permit, but some newer subdivisions carry HOA rules, we'll help you check before we schedule.

Most Oak Creek removals land between $400 and $2,500. Price is driven by height, trunk diameter, condition, and access. A straightforward backyard maple with room to drop is at the low end; a large dead ash leaning over a roof with no equipment access is at the high end. We price on site and the number does not change afterward.
Yes, and it is most of what we do here. We take the tree apart from the top down, rig heavy pieces to the ground on ropes, and keep a controlled drop zone the whole time. Nothing free-falls near a structure.
Haul-away is included by default. If you want firewood rounds left behind, tell us at the estimate and we will stack them. Please follow Wisconsin guidance on not transporting firewood off the property.
Trees fully on your private property generally do not need a permit. Trees in the terrace or right-of-way between the sidewalk and the street belong to the municipality and cannot be removed by a private contractor. We confirm which one you have before we quote.
